Re: Different Chunking in MUR SST

Thanks for the feedback on the GeoTIFF applications. We do have long range plans to update the coordinate variables (time, lat, lon) to doubles in our data model. When we designed this model in the early 2000s file size was still an issue so we went with floats vs doubles. Now it is less an issue bu...
